#b1801f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b1801f is composed of 69.4% red, 50.2% green and 12.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 27.7% magenta, 82.5% yellow and 30.6% black. It has a hue angle of 39.9 degrees, a saturation of 70.2% and a lightness of 40.8%. #b1801f color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ff3e with #630100. Closest websafe color is: #999933.

#b1801f color description : Dark orange [Brown tone].

#b1801f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b1801f has RGB values of R:177, G:128, B:31 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.28, Y:0.82,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 11632671.

Shades and Tints of #b1801f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0702 is the darkest color, while #fefc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b1801f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#696867 is the less saturated color, while #c98807 is the most saturated one.
